Ramona Real Estate

The median home value in Ramona, OK is $122,100. This is higher than the county median home value of $96,100. The national median home value is $219,700. The average price of homes sold in Ramona, OK is $122,100. Approximately 54.51% of Ramona homes are owned, compared to 25.49% rented, while 20% are vacant. Ramona real estate listings include condos, townhomes, and single family homes for sale. Commercial properties are also available. Ramona, Oklahoma has a population of 494. Ramona is more family-centric than the surrounding county with 30.23%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 29.2%.

The median household income in Ramona, Oklahoma is $32,000. The median household income for the surrounding county is $50,388 compared to the national median of $57,652. The median age of people living in Ramona is 44.5 years.

Ramona Weather

The average high temperature in July is 92.1 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 24.5 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 42.6 inches per year, with 4.6 inches of snow per year.
